Python Networkx MultiDiGraph - изменить / назначить краевые ключи из pandas кадра данных вместо целого числа по умолчанию - PullRequest
0 голосов
/ 17 июня 2020

Я создаю сеть с помощью NetworkX, используя приведенный ниже код, который отлично работает. Однако я хочу иметь возможность указать (если возможно) ключ ребра, который назначается каждому ребру (между некоторыми узлами есть несколько ребер). NetworkX по умолчанию назначает ключ минимально возможному целому числу, но я бы хотел, чтобы он был одним из краевых атрибутов. Можно ли это сделать во время настройки сети? или постфактум?

Net = nx.from_pandas_edgelist(G, source='K', target='S', edge_attr=['A', 'B', 'C','D'], create_using=nx.MultiDiGraph())
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...